Practising law in Punjab
Principal High Court: Punjab and Haryana High Court · Capital: Chandigarh
The Punjab and Haryana High Court at Chandigarh (1966) serves both Punjab and Haryana, as well as the Union Territory of Chandigarh. Stamp duty in Punjab follows the Indian Stamp (Punjab Amendment) Act. The East Punjab Urban Rent Restriction Act, 1949 governs rent matters. The Bar Council of Punjab and Haryana (BCPH) maintains rolls for both States.
